Safety Precaution - Static Electricity Follow these simple precautions to protect yourself from harm and the products from damage. To avoid electrical shock, always disconnect the power from the PC chassis before working on it. Don't touch any components on the CPU card or other cards while the PC is on. Disconnect power before making any configuration changes. The sudden rush of power when connecting a jumper or installing a card may damage sensitive electronic components.

1.1 Introduction Congratulations on selecting this new Advantech product! The PPC-S155T panel PC is a Pentium® M (to 2.0GHz) processor-based UltraSlim panel computer that is designed to serve as a human machine interface (HMI) and multimedia computer. It is a PC-based system complete with a 15” color TFT LCD display, on-board PCI Ethernet controller, multi-COM port interfaces and an 18-bit stereo audio controller.

2.2 Installation Procedures 2.2.1 Connecting the power cord The panel PC can only be powered by a DC electrical outlet (16Vdc ~ 25Vdc, 3.5A max.). Be sure to always handle the power cords by holding the plug ends only. Please follow Figure 2-5 to connect the male plug of the power cord to the DC inlet of the panel PC. Figure 2.5 Connecting the power cord to the DC inlet 2.2.
The power switch is located on the right side of the computer, as shown in Figure 2-6 and Figure 2-7. When the switch is in the horizontal position as shown in Figure 2-6, it is in the locked status. It is possible to set it to avoid accidental opening or closing of the computer power supply. When the switch is in the vertical position, as shown in Figure 2-7, it can be pushed to open or close the computer power supply. Power switch (Lock status) Chapter 2 2.2.

3.1 Overview The panel PC consists of a PC-based computer that is housed in a protective plastic panel divided between the front and back halves. Any maintenance or hardware upgrades can be completed after removing both of these panels. To access only the HDD, SDRAM, or CPU, it is only necessary to remove the CPU and heatsink cover and the HDD bracket.. Warning! Do not remove the plastic covers until verifying that no power is flowing inside the panel PC.
Chapter 3 3.3 Installing the SDRAM Memory Module and CPU The panel PC's central processing unit (CPU) can be upgraded to improve system performance. The panel PC provides one 478-pin ZIF (Zero Insertion Force) socket (Socket 478). The CPU must be fitted with a heat sink and CPU fan to prevent overheating. The panel PC also provides two 200-pin SODIMM sockets which can accept two DDR 266 SDRAM memory modules up to 2 GB. Warning! The CPU may be damaged if operated without a heat sink and a fan.

4.1 Setting Jumpers and Switches It is possible to configure the panel PC to match the needs of the application by resetting the jumpers. A jumper is the simplest kind of electrical switch. It consists of two metal pins and a small metal clip, often protected by a plastic cover that slides over the pins to connect them. To “close” a jumper, connect the pins with the clip. To “open” a jumper, remove the clip. Sometimes a jumper has three pins, labeled 1, 2, and 3.

5.1 Introduction The PPC-S155T uses the combination of Intel 915GME north bridge and Intel 82801FBM ICH6 Mobile chipsets. The Mobile Intel® 915GME Chipset is an optimized integrated graphics solution with a 400 MHz and 533 MHz front-side bus. The integrated 32-bit 3D graphics engine, based on Intel® Graphics Media Accelerator 900 (Intel® GMA 900) architecture, operates at core speeds of up to 333 MHz.

8.1 Introduction The ALC650 is an 18-bit, full duplex AC’97 2.2 compatible stereo audio CODEC designed for PC multimedia systems, including host/soft audio and AMR/CNR based designs. The ALC650 incorporates proprietary converter technology to achieve a high SNR, greater than 90 dB. The ALC650 AC’97 CODEC supports multiple CODEC extensions with independent variable sampling rates and built-in 3D effects.

9.1 Introduction 9.1.1 General information The PPC-S155T has an optional touchscreen that incorporates advanced secondgeneration resistive, impact-resistant technology. It permits 75% light transmission. The resistive model features an antiglare surface. This model provides enhanced visual resolution. It also has a new and improved scratch-resistant surface. The touchscreen is manufactured from UL-recognized components.
